Anyway, I've air chiselled the old bushes out but I cant see how to get the new ones in. The problem is that the rubber sticks out a long way on the front so you cant drive it it with a hammer and bush driver as I would a normal metallised bush.
Will they go in just by bashing them with a hammer and a suitable size piece of tube?
can anyone report on how they've done this using only DIY tools?

Place the bushings in the sun for a while or get them pretty warm, so they become real pliable. If they are polyurethane bushings, warming them up may not help much but you could try it.
Your idea about a pipe seems like it may work, but may hurt the bushing, be careful if you do it that way.
